Today we will be discussing Nootropics, or smart drugs, and how they came to be.
“Humanity will not wait millions of years until Mother Nature will hand it a functionally better brain...[Humankind] will directly, openly and consciously take part in evolution.” - Corneliu Giurgea (1923-1995), Father of the Nootropic Concept.
